Abstract :
Digital image processing is a very important field within machine vision. Because of it is hard to implement real time image processing operations through software techniques, image processing field is one of the most active areas for reconfigurable computing. This paper introduces a new PCI-based system for real time image processing with reconfigurable hardware. The system uses the HOT2-XL PCI board, and we have implemented a Visual C++ application in order to validate our hardware designs. This environment is based on a library of hardware modules implementing some of the most common operations in image processing. The practical results show that our hardware modules get real time processing, a minimum resource use and a high operation frequency
